Shirataki noodles are popular in the japanese cuisine, and are made from a kind of potato called konnyaku. It would be complicated to make and you have better to check in asian shops to find it. Basically you can include it in japanese soups (ex miso), which would be quite delicious by mixing miso pastry with tofu, mushrooms and some vegetables. If the soup contains meat (ex: nabe) then shirataki noodles can also be included.
